1. Environmental and Health Hazards A broken sewer line can leak harmful sewage into the environment, potentially contaminating the ground and water sources. This poses serious health risks, as sewage can contain bacteria, viruses, and parasites. Immediate action is necessary to mitigate these dangers and protect both health and the environment.
2. Property Damage Sewage backups caused by a broken line can lead to significant water damage inside your home. This includes damage to floors, walls, and personal belongings. The longer the issue goes unaddressed, the greater the potential for mold growth and structural damage, necessitating extensive water mitigation efforts in Toledo.
3. Foul Odors One of the first signs of a broken sewer line is the presence of persistent, foul odors. These unpleasant smells not only make your living space uncomfortable but also indicate a serious underlying issue that requires immediate attention from professionals skilled in handling backed up drains in Toledo.
4. Increased Costs Ignoring a broken sewer line can lead to more severe complications, significantly increasing the cost of repairs over time. Early detection and repair are crucial in managing costs and preventing the escalation of damage.

6. Prevention Tips Regular inspections and maintenance are key to preventing sewer line issues. Avoid flushing non-degradable items down the toilet and be mindful of planting trees near sewer lines, as roots can cause breaks and clogs.
